To minimize EMI problems in a complex system containing multiple electronic modules, each module must satisfy two goals: it must minimize unwanted emissions, and it must minimize susceptibility to interference from other sources. Nowadays, definitive radiation is an almost exclusive indication for unresectable tumors and for patients with poorer prognosis for whom surgical procedures may be exceptionally mutilating.
